Understanding Data Loss Problems
Common Causes of Data Loss
Data loss can occur in many ways, often when users least expect it. Some of the most common causes include accidental deletion, formatting of storage devices, corrupted files, software malfunctions, power outages, and cyber threats such as ransomware. Hardware failures, including damaged hard drives or faulty storage media, also contribute significantly to data loss incidents.
Impact on Individuals and Businesses
For individuals, data loss may involve losing personal photos, documents, or academic work. For businesses, the consequences are far more severe, ranging from lost customer records and financial data to disrupted operations and reputational damage. In many cases, data recovery is not just about convenience but about survival and continuity.
